Actor Ian Smith, who played Harold Bishop in Neighbours, has said that his terminal cancer diagnosis put him in a “cruel, ugly, brutal place”.

The 86-year-old actor, known for playing the former cafe owner in the Australian soap, revealed last year that he has a rare form of lung cancer called pulmonary pleomorphic carcinoma.
